Hi,
we have migrated to Linux and have a situation where when you ckout a file
that is already checked out or locked for another release, we are getting
"co: /qad/rcs/mfgpro/char/utdzn.p,v: multiple revisions locked by dzn;
please specify one".  We were thinking as a work around to just ignore this
error because it still checks out the file.  Is this okay to do or is there
a better solution?
